I'm sure you know the movie Minority Report and you'll remember the interface Tom Cruise uses to navigate in all the information he needs to build a story from the mind pictures.

The pointscreen is pretty close to that vision. You just stand in front of the glass or whatever material looks cool and move your hand. The movement is repeated on the screen. That way you move the mouse symbollinks
(the symbol no real mouse anymore) and the functions of the software.

The interface works with an electric field around your body that is able o capture 3D-movements and interpret them into computer actions. Cool. A bit slow but it's still new and improvements not that hard at all.
